On Wed, 23 Jan 2002, Raj wrote:

> I just read on a site that the kernel versions ending in odd numbers
> are meant to be for testing purposes and the releases with even
> numbers are final/stable.

This scheme is for the second number of the kernel version. for example
you may not want to use 2.5.x or 2.3.x. but 2.4.x are perfectly alright.

> Is this true? I hope it's not. If YES then I would then use 2.4.16
> instead.

You can safely use 2.4.17. it is a stable release.
